SQM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

254 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sociedad Química y Minera de Chile (SQM)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$2.66B — up 3.8% from $2.56B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 53 funds opened new SQM positions and 41 closed out — a net gain of 12 holders — while 77 added to existing stakes and 77 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Marshall Wace, adding an estimated $98.3M. The largest seller was Banco BTG Pactual, exiting entirely with an estimated $80.8M sold.
